随笔分类 - database
摘要:查看當前用戶下的表:select * from tabselect * from catselect * from user_tables查看所有的表:select * from all_tablesselect * from dba_tables查看當前用戶下的表的列:select * from ...
阅读全文
摘要:使用 cursor对象的description获取列名printcur.description'''.descriptionThisread-onlyattributeisasequenceof7-itemsequences.Eachofthesesequencescontainsinformati...
阅读全文
摘要:ORACLE_SID参数,这个参数是操作系统中用到的,它是描述我们要默认连接的数据库实例,对于一个机器上有多个实例的情况下,要修改后才能通过conn/assysdba连接,因为这里用到了默认的实例名。简而言之,打个比方,你的名字叫小明,但是你有很多外号。你父母叫你小明,但是朋友都叫你的外号。这里你的...
阅读全文
摘要:Case具有两种格式。简单Case函数和Case搜索函数。--简单Case函数CASE sex WHEN '1' THEN '男' WHEN '2' THEN '女'ELSE '其他'END --Case搜索函数CASE WHEN sex= '1' THEN '男' WHENsex = '2' T...
阅读全文
摘要:Linux环境下修改MySQL端口方法:[mysqld]port = 3306 #修改为你想要改的端口 vi /etc/my.cnfdatadir=/var/lib/mysqlsocket=/var/lib/mysql/mysql.sock[mysql.server]user=mysqlbasedi...
阅读全文
摘要:相同点:1.truncate和不带where子句的delete、以及drop都会删除表内的数据。2.drop、truncate都是DDL语句(数据定义语言),执行后会自动提交。不同点:1. truncate 和 delete 只删除数据不删除表的结构(定义)drop 语句将删除表的结构被依赖的约束(...
阅读全文
摘要:select t1.*, t2.sfrom emp_hiloo t1 join (select deptno, avg(salary) s from emp_hiloo group by deptno) t2 on t1.deptno=t2.deptnowhere t1.salary>t2.ss...
阅读全文
摘要:今天来写写union的用法及一些需要注意的。union:联合的意思,即把两次或多次查询结果合并起来。要求:两次查询的列数必须一致推荐:列的类型可以不一样,但推荐查询的每一列,想对应的类型以一样可以来自多张表的数据:多次sql语句取出的列名可以不一致,此时以第一个sql语句的列名为准。如果不同的语句中...
阅读全文
摘要:%代表任意多个字符 _代表一个字符 在 MySQL中,SQL的模式缺省是忽略大小写的正则模式使用REGEXP和NOT REGEXP操作符。“.”匹配任何单个的字符。一个字符类“[...]”匹配在方括号内的任意单个字符 “ * ”匹配零个或多个在它前面的东西正则表达式是区分大小写的,但是如果你希望,你...
阅读全文
摘要:mysql 查询前5条记录:select * from stuinfo limit 5;以下的文章主要是介绍Python模块功能的介绍,以及相关接数据库的连接对象的代码的示例,以及Python模块功能的参数列表的详细解析,以下就是文章的相关内容的详细介绍,让我们一起分享相关的内容吧!Python模块...
阅读全文
摘要:‘’‘#选择数据库 conn.select_db('python');提交操作:conn.commit()回滚操作:conn.rollback()获取最近查询表的字段个数:conn.field_count上次查询或更新所发生行数:cursor.rowcountexcute(sql , 单挑数据元组)...
阅读全文
摘要:做个记录:1、删除 mysql1sudoapt-getautoremove--purgemysql-server-5.02sudoapt-getremovemysql-server3sudoapt-getautoremovemysql-server4sudoapt-getremovemysql-c...
阅读全文
摘要:对于Linux来说,有多重包管理系统和安装机制。如果使用的是包含某种包管理器的Linux,那么可以很轻松的安装PythonMySQLdb库。Linux Fedora, CentOS系统:yum installMySQL-pythonLinux Ubuntu操作系统:apt-get installpy...
阅读全文
Ubuntu 12.04 安装mysql及mysql-python 分类: python Module ubuntu database 2014-01-23 10:07 615人阅读 评论(0) 收藏
摘要:1、安装python开发包:sudo apt-get install python-dev2、安装mysql服务端、客户端及扩展包:sudo apt-get install mysql-server mysql-clientlibmysqlclient-dev3、安装python第三方库管理工具:s...
阅读全文
摘要:ubuntu 下安装python开发包,执行命令 sudo apt-get install python-dev,报错;Reading package lists... Error!E: Encountered a section with no Package: headerE: Problem ...
阅读全文

浙公网安备 33010602011771号